Remarks
Some references may be clicked to view in new window. Roll over index number to view submission details.
1 Otero, Sebastian Alberto J-K= 0.24; B-V= 0.48. ASAS-3 magnitudes contaminated by 2MASS J17053345-2400231 (V= 16.1; sep. 5"), 2MASS J17053322-2400378 (V= 16.8; sep. 10") and 2MASS J17053439-2400460 (V= 16.5; sep. 22"). Range has been corrected.
